Journal: Journal of immunology (Baltimore, Md. : 1950)
Article Title: Direct stimulation of human T cells via TLR5 and TLR7/8: flagellin and R-848 up-regulate proliferation and IFN-gamma production by memory CD4+ T cells.
doi: 10.4049/jimmunol.175.3.1551
Figure Lengend Snippet: FIGURE 5. Memory T cells are more sensitive to Pam3CSK4, flagellin, and R-848 than naive T cells. Naive (CD45RA) () and memory (CD45RO) T cells (u) were purified from CD4 T cells by FACS sorting and either unstimulated or stimulated with IL-2 (100 U/ml for cytokine production or 20 U/ml for proliferation assay) or anti-CD2 mAbs (2 g/ml) in the absence or presence of 1 g/ml Pam3CSK4, 5 g/ml flagellin, or 1 g/ml R-848. IFN- was quantified in the 48-h cell-free supernatants (A), and proliferation was determined after 72 h (B). Results are expressed as mean SD, n 3, and are representative of the data obtained with the T cells of two of six healthy donors.

Journal: Cardiovascular Diabetology
Article Title: Cardioprotective mechanism of ω-3 fatty acid icosapent ethyl (IPE) in cardiomyocytes: role in high glucose and shear stress-induced mechano-transduction dysregulation
doi: 10.1186/s12933-025-03033-8
Figure Lengend Snippet: IPE effects on inflammation and oxidative stress in a dynamic shear stress model of cardiomyocytes. A , B , E qRT-PCR for NF-kB ( A , left panel), IL-6 ( B , left panel), SOD2 ( E , left panel) in AC16 cells exposed to NG, NG FLOW, NG FLOW + IPE. β-Actin was used as internal control. The fold increase of mRNA expression compared with NG was calculated using the 2 −ΔΔCt method. Data are mean ± SEM. * P < 0.05 vs NG; ** P < 0.05 vs NG FLOW. Western blot for p-NF-kB ( A , right panel), IL-6 ( B , right panel), Catalase ( D ), SOD2 ( E , right panel) in cardiomyocytes AC16 in NG, NG FLOW, NG FLOW + IPE. The histograms show the densitometric analysis of 3 separate experiments representing the relative expression; NG value was set as 1. * P < 0.05 vs NG; ** P < 0.05 vs NG FLOW
